Gujarat Titans (GT) head coach Ashish Nehra has declined the idea of trading all-rounder Washington Sundar to Chennai Super Kings (CSK) ahead of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 auction, according to reports by Cricbuzz. A few weeks ago, there were reports that CSK are interested in acquiring Sundar in their squad for the next season.

The Men in Yellow explored the idea of having the Indian all-rounder in their side following Ravichandran Ashwin’s retirement from IPL. However, Nehra refused the idea of trading the spin all-rounder from their squad and conveyed his decision to the five-time champions.

The GT management had already made it clear long ago that they have no intention to part ways with a player they have heavily invested in. GT shelled out Rs. 3.20 crore to acquire Sundar during the IPL 2025 auction.

The 26-year-old featured in only six games for the Titans in IPL 2025, scoring 133 runs at a strike rate of 166.25 and clinching two wickets at an economy of 10.25. However, since the last season, he has become an all-format player for India.

Sundar was part of the Shubman Gill-led India in the Anderson Tendulkar Trophy 2025, where he slammed his maiden test century against England at Emirates Old Trafford, Manchester, in the fourth test. He also clinched a four-wicket haul in the third game at The Lord’s.

In the ongoing India tour of Australia 2025, the spin all-rounder was inducted into both ODI and T20I squads. In the recent third T20I against Australia at Bellerive Oval in Hobart, he smacked a match-winning knock of unbeaten 49 runs of 23 balls, helping India chase a 187-run target by five wickets.
